Light-Emitting Diode Mesh Drape Displays: Design & Fields
LED mesh drape displays are reshaping the landscape of retail design. These innovative systems consist of a tightly woven mesh upon which miniature illuminated lights are mounted, creating a flexible and visually stunning surface. Unlike rigid LED displays, mesh curtains can be arranged over complex forms, offering unparalleled creative freedom for architects. Common applications include dynamic advertising in storefronts, captivating visual presentations at shows, and immersive creative installations that blur the lines between physical space and digital content. The perforated nature of the mesh allows light to pass behind, minimizing obstruction and maximizing visual presence – a significant advantage compared to traditional, opaque displays. Building LED Fabric Incorporation
The burgeoning trend of architectural design now frequently involves the integrated implementation of digital fabric technology. This groundbreaking approach allows creatives to transform building exteriors into dynamic visual canvases, presenting everything from static branding to complex, animated imagery. Compared to get more info traditional signage, fabric displays offer a level of flexibility and creative freedom that is simply unmatched, while also providing advantages for resource efficiency through targeted illumination and responsive content scheduling. The complexities often relate to physical incorporation, weather longevity, and maintaining image quality across varying ambient conditions.
